+;;; Commentary:
+
+;; Org-Babel support for evaluating fortran code.
+
+;;; Code:
+(require 'ob)
+(require 'org-macs)
+(require 'cc-mode)
+(require 'cl-lib)
+
+(declare-function org-entry-get "org"
+ (pom property &optional inherit literal-nil))
+
+(defvar org-babel-tangle-lang-exts)
+(add-to-list 'org-babel-tangle-lang-exts '("fortran" . "F90"))
+
+(defvar org-babel-default-header-args:fortran '())
+
+(defcustom org-babel-fortran-compiler "gfortran"
+ "Fortran command used to compile Fortran source code file."
+ :group 'org-babel
+ :package-version '(Org . "9.5")
+ :type 'string)
+
+(defun org-babel-execute:fortran (body params)
+ "This function should only be called by `org-babel-execute:fortran'."
+ (let* ((tmp-src-file (org-babel-temp-file "fortran-src-" ".F90"))
+ (tmp-bin-file (org-babel-temp-file "fortran-bin-" org-babel-exeext))
+ (cmdline (cdr (assq :cmdline params)))
+ (flags (cdr (assq :flags params)))
+ (full-body (org-babel-expand-body:fortran body params)))
+ (with-temp-file tmp-src-file (insert full-body))
+ (org-babel-eval
+ (format "%s -o %s %s %s"
+ org-babel-fortran-compiler
+ (org-babel-process-file-name tmp-bin-file)
+ (mapconcat 'identity
+ (if (listp flags) flags (list flags)) " ")
+ (org-babel-process-file-name tmp-src-file)) "")
+ (let ((results
+ (org-trim
+ (org-remove-indentation
+ (org-babel-eval
+ (concat tmp-bin-file (if cmdline (concat " " cmdline) "")) "")))))
+ (org-babel-reassemble-table
+ (org-babel-result-cond (cdr (assq :result-params params))
+ (org-babel-read results)
+ (let ((tmp-file (org-babel-temp-file "f-")))
+ (with-temp-file tmp-file (insert results))
+ (org-babel-import-elisp-from-file tmp-file)))
+ (org-babel-pick-name
+ (cdr (assq :colname-names params)) (cdr (assq :colnames params)))
+ (org-babel-pick-name
+ (cdr (assq :rowname-names params)) (cdr (assq :rownames params)))))))
+
+(defun org-babel-expand-body:fortran (body params)
+ "Expand a block of fortran or fortran code with org-babel according to
+its header arguments."
+ (let ((vars (org-babel--get-vars params))
+ (main-p (not (string= (cdr (assq :main params)) "no")))
+ (includes (or (cdr (assq :includes params))
+ (org-babel-read (org-entry-get nil "includes" t))))
+ (defines (org-babel-read
+ (or (cdr (assq :defines params))
+ (org-babel-read (org-entry-get nil "defines" t))))))
+ (mapconcat 'identity
+ (list
+ ;; includes
+ (mapconcat
+ (lambda (inc) (format "#include %s" inc))
+ (if (listp includes) includes (list includes)) "\n")
+ ;; defines
+ (mapconcat
+ (lambda (inc) (format "#define %s" inc))
+ (if (listp defines) defines (list defines)) "\n")
+ ;; body
+ (if main-p
+ (org-babel-fortran-ensure-main-wrap
+ (concat
+ ;; variables
+ (mapconcat 'org-babel-fortran-var-to-fortran vars "\n")
+ body)
+ params)
+ body) "\n") "\n")))
+
+(defun org-babel-fortran-ensure-main-wrap (body params)
+ "Wrap body in a \"program ... end program\" block if none exists."
+ (if (string-match "^[ \t]*program\\>" (capitalize body))
+ (let ((vars (org-babel--get-vars params)))
+ (when vars (error "Cannot use :vars if `program' statement is present"))
+ body)
+ (format "program main\n%s\nend program main\n" body)))
+
+(defun org-babel-prep-session:fortran (_session _params)
+ "This function does nothing as fortran is a compiled language with no
+support for sessions."
+ (error "Fortran is a compiled languages -- no support for sessions"))
+
+(defun org-babel-load-session:fortran (_session _body _params)
+ "This function does nothing as fortran is a compiled language with no
+support for sessions."
+ (error "Fortran is a compiled languages -- no support for sessions"))
+
+;; helper functions
+
+(defun org-babel-fortran-var-to-fortran (pair)
+ "Convert an elisp val into a string of fortran code specifying a var
+of the same value."
+ ;; TODO list support
+ (let ((var (car pair))
+ (val (cdr pair)))
+ (when (symbolp val)
+ (setq val (symbol-name val))
+ (when (= (length val) 1)
+ (setq val (string-to-char val))))
+ (cond
+ ((integerp val)
+ (format "integer, parameter :: %S = %S\n" var val))
+ ((floatp val)
+ (format "real, parameter :: %S = %S\n" var val))
+ ((or (integerp val))
+ (format "character, parameter :: %S = '%S'\n" var val))
+ ((stringp val)
+ (format "character(len=%d), parameter :: %S = '%s'\n"
+ (length val) var val))
+ ;; val is a matrix
+ ((and (listp val) (cl-every #'listp val))
+ (format "real, parameter :: %S(%d,%d) = transpose( reshape( %s , (/ %d, %d /) ) )\n"
+ var (length val) (length (car val))
+ (org-babel-fortran-transform-list val)
+ (length (car val)) (length val)))
+ ((listp val)
+ (format "real, parameter :: %S(%d) = %s\n"
+ var (length val) (org-babel-fortran-transform-list val)))
+ (t
+ (error "The type of parameter %s is not supported by ob-fortran" var)))))
+
+(defun org-babel-fortran-transform-list (val)
+ "Return a fortran representation of enclose syntactic lists."
+ (if (listp val)
+ (concat "(/" (mapconcat #'org-babel-fortran-transform-list val ", ") "/)")
+ (format "%S" val)))
+
+(provide 'ob-fortran)
+
+;;; ob-fortran.el ends here
